The gene lame duck is referred to in FlyBase by the symbol Dmellmd (CG4677, FBgn0039039). It is a protein_coding_gene from Dmel. It has 2 annotated transcripts and 2 polypeptides (all unique). Gene sequence location is 3R:23021222..23026713. Its molecular function is described by: RNA polymerase II cis-regulatory region sequence-specific DNA binding; DNA-binding transcription factor activity, RNA polymerase II-specific. It is involved in the biological process described with 8 unique terms, many of which group under: developmental process; muscle structure development; multicellular organismal process; anatomical structure development; multicellular organism development. 30 alleles are reported. The phenotypes of these alleles manifest in: non-connected developing system; myoblast; adult tagma; cuboidal/columnar epithelium; dorsal closure embryo. The phenotypic classes of alleles include: lethal; viable; visible. Summary of modENCODE Temporal Expression Profile: Temporal profile ranges from a peak of high expression to a trough of extremely low expression. Peak expression observed within 06-12 hour embryonic stages.
